Genesis 1 - 1st Book of Bible
A glorious picture, where life was characterized by blessings and everything was working according to God’s plan. J Thus “God saw all that he had made and it was very good” (Genesis 1:31). This confirms that both humanity and creation were not designed for either sickness or death, but for the good. 

Slide 5 - Tekstslide

What went wrong? 
Genesis 3 presents an unfortunate scenario where humanity falls into sin and disobedience. So God justly punished humanity for their disobedience. To the woman, he said “I will greatly increase your pain in childbearing,” and to the man, “Cursed is the ground because of you, in pain, you shall eat of it all the days of your life” (Genesis 3:16-18). Other reasons for sickness
  • Sickness can be the consequence of having committed sin (Drunkeness, gluttony)
  • Sickness can be the discipline of the Lord. (Believers)
  • Sickness can be the means of the judgment of God. (non-believers)
  • Sickness can be used to reveal God's glory.

Why do we heal the sick? 
Mark 16:18 Jesus commands his disciples to preach, teach, and to heal 
Luke 9:1 When Jesus had called the Twelve together, he gave them power and authority to drive out all demons and to cure diseases, 2 and he sent them out to preach the kingdom of God and to heal the sick.
Matthew 10:1 He called his twelve disciples to him and gave them authority to drive out evil spirits and to heal every disease and sickness. 8 Heal the sick, raise the dead, cleanse those who have leprosy, drive out demons. 9 Heal the sick who are there and tell them, ‘The kingdom of God is near you.’

Sacrament of Healing
  1. The sacrament of healing continues the ministry of Christ. 
  2. Strengthens our faith in God and Jesus when we are sick or dying. 
  3. Gives us hope and courage.
